Output 2dde104cfe677823b55603a134cc29acd020ce7b2d24c2a5e0820f5051c9a977:13

value
136601307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f5922252e381b91cb372e2700b23e0f1b04348 OP_EQUAL
address
MU8mkPKD2jGtNRASfhEYp6DWy5MtAQmboY
transaction
2dde104cfe677823b55603a134cc29acd020ce7b2d24c2a5e0820f5051c9a977
spent
true